Javascript VoxForge speech recorder
The VoxForge speech recorder is a Progressive Web App, hosted on Github, that has the ability to record your audio submissions from a browser (or offline as an app) and upload to our server.
Turn off any other audio programs on your PC (i.e. music players, audio editors, etc.)
Position your mike so it does not pick up your breathing. While recording, try to minimize any non-speech noises (i.e. exhaling, taking a breath, lip smacking, ...) or background noise.
The black box near the bottom of your screen will display the audio waveform of your recording. Please record a test recording to ensure your microphone volume is not too loud or too soft.

For each prompt line, please record your speech as follows:
If you make a mistake, click Record again to re-record your prompt.
Please do not read the punctuation marks out loud.
Once you have completed recording all ten prompts the Upload button will activate. Click the Upload button to upload your entire submission to the VoxForge repository as a single zip file.
